aboutsummaryrefslogtreecommitdiff
path: root/create-keys.sh
blob: 5cfda45aad4b6a5e8ddf1db2eb53721497e8f4ec (plain) (blame)
1
2
3
4
5
6
7
8
9
10
11
#!/bin/sh -

. ./environment.sh

# Not really sure which silly name to use for the EC curve, doc is not great.  prime256v1?  ansiX9p256r1?  secp256r1?
# If I had to guess, ansiX9p256r1, so try that:   --key-type EC:ansiX9p256r1
# Still having trouble with OpenSSL using this key, so revert to RSA for now, try ECDSA again later.

pkcs11-tool --module ${PKCS11_MODULE} --login --pin ${PKCS11_PIN} --keypairgen --id 1 --label leader  --key-type rsa:2048
pkcs11-tool --module ${PKCS11_MODULE} --login --pin ${PKCS11_PIN} --keypairgen --id 2 --label boris   --key-type rsa:2048
pkcs11-tool --module ${PKCS11_MODULE} --login --pin ${PKCS11_PIN} --keypairgen --id 3 --label natasha --key-type rsa:2848